GS7B014641FFT Description

GS7B014641FFT Description

The GS7B014641FFT from TT Electronics/IRC is a high-performance ceramic resistor network designed for precision applications in demanding electronic circuits. Housed in a 14-pin narrow SOIC package, this bussed (BUS) network integrates 13 thin-film resistors, each with a 4.64KΩ resistance and a tight ±1% absolute tolerance. The device operates over a wide temperature range of 70°C to 125°C with a derated power capability, ensuring reliability in thermally challenging environments. Its ±100ppm/°C temperature coefficient and 100V maximum voltage rating make it suitable for stable, low-drift applications. The SOIC-C series construction features a rectangular ceramic case with gull-wing terminations, optimized for surface-mount (SMD) assembly.

GS7B014641FFT Features

  • Precision Performance: Thin-film technology delivers ±1% tolerance on both absolute and ratio values, critical for matched impedance or voltage divider circuits.
  • Robust Construction: Ceramic substrate enhances thermal stability and mechanical durability compared to polymer-based networks.
  • High-Density Integration: 13 resistors in a compact 8.66mm × 5.99mm footprint (SOIC-14) save PCB space.
  • Derated Power Handling: 0.05W per resistor (0.7W total) ensures sustained performance at elevated temperatures.
  • Automation-Friendly: 1.27mm terminal pitch and gull-wing leads simplify pick-and-place assembly.
  • Non-Automotive: Not PPAP-capable, ideal for industrial/commercial use where automotive compliance isn’t required.

GS7B014641FFT Applications

  • Analog Signal Conditioning: Precision dividers or pull-up networks in data acquisition systems.
  • Medical Electronics: Stable resistance for patient monitoring equipment where drift is unacceptable.
  • Test & Measurement: Calibration circuits requiring matched resistor ratios.
  • Power Management: Voltage reference networks in DC-DC converters or LDO regulators.
  • Industrial Controls: PLC modules benefiting from the ceramic package’s vibration resistance.
